SAP-C02 Design for New Solutions Practice Question
A company is designing a new system to ingest and process real-time streaming data from thousands of IoT devices. The system must be able to handle variable throughput and provide durable storage for the data. The data will be processed by a Lambda function and then stored in Amazon S3. Which two services should be used together to build this ingestion pipeline?
⚠ Common exam trap
Candidates often confuse Kinesis Data Firehose with Kinesis Data Streams, assuming Firehose's direct S3 delivery is sufficient, but they miss that Firehose cannot trigger Lambda per-record processing and lacks the durable, replayable stream storage required for real-time IoT ingestion with Lambda.

Amazon Kinesis Data Streams (Option D) is the correct ingestion service because it provides durable, real-time data streaming with shard-level persistence for up to 365 days, enabling Lambda to process records in near real-time with at-least-once delivery semantics. AWS Lambda (Option A) is the correct processing service because it can be configured as a consumer of the Kinesis stream via event source mapping, scaling automatically with the number of shards to handle variable throughput without managing servers.

AWS S3 Storage Class Comparison
| Storage Class | Min Duration | Retrieval | Use Case |
|---|---|---|---|
| S3 Standard | None | Immediate | Frequently accessed data |
| S3 Standard-IA | 30 days | Immediate | Infrequent access, rapid retrieval |
| S3 One Zone-IA | 30 days | Immediate | Non-critical infrequent data |
| S3 Intelligent-Tiering | None | Immediate–hours | Unknown or changing access patterns |
| S3 Glacier Instant | 90 days | Milliseconds | Archive with instant retrieval |
| S3 Glacier Flexible | 90 days | Minutes–hours | Archive, flexible retrieval |
| S3 Glacier Deep Archive | 180 days | Hours | Long-term compliance archive |
